>Generic brand cereal tends to be just as good as the real stuff, http://www.associatedcontent.com/article/234043/the_difference_between_name_brand_foods.html?cat=46It isn't odd for name brands to sell their product under a generic label so that they can appeal to consumers wanting to be cheap. So it may not be that the cereal is just as good, but that it is the same.
